Prachanda opposes plan to remove Deputy Speaker



KATHMANDU: Pushpa Kamal Dahal, chair of the main opposition Maoist Center, has opposed attempts by the ruling parties to remove Deputy Speaker Indira Rana Magar.

Speaking to journalists at the party office in Paris Danda on Tuesday, Dahal said that the Nepali Congress and CPN-UML would be making a mistake by trying to oust the Deputy Speaker, and that the Maoist Center would actively resist such efforts.

He criticized the current coalition government led by KP Sharma Oli, stating that it has accomplished little beyond mistakes since coming to power.

Dahal also condemned the attempt to remove a socially active indigenous woman from her position, calling it unjustified. He further described the allegations against Deputy Speaker Rana as fabricated. The controversy stems from her previous action of writing a letter to the U.S. Embassy concerning unrelated individuals, which drew her into public scrutiny.
